Late spring through early autumn (May to September) offers the most comfortable weather for lakeside visits. Summer peaks at July-August with warmest temperatures and longest daylight hours, though you'll encounter more crowds. We'd recommend visiting in June or September if you prefer quieter settings—the water's still warm enough for gentle wading, and the natural scenery is equally stunning with fewer tourists around.
Absolutely. The Šumava region offers trails ranging from gentle 2-3 km walks suitable for most fitness levels to more challenging 8+ km hikes for experienced walkers. We've specifically curated beginner-friendly routes that feature minimal elevation gain, well-maintained paths, and rest areas with benches every 1-2 km. Many trails also pass through charming villages where you can stop for refreshment and local hospitality.
